【问题标题】:How get WEB-INF folder path in java JAX-WS app如何在 java JAX-WS 应用程序中获取 WEB-INF 文件夹路径
【发布时间】:2012-02-11 23:08:50
【问题描述】:

我有一个带有 java bean 的 java webservice 应用程序。 我如何确定 WEB-INF 目录中文件的完整路径。

【问题讨论】:

    标签: java resources web-inf applicationcontext


    【解决方案1】:

    你为什么需要这个? 一种方法是从您的 jsp/servlet 到 getServletContext().getResourceAsStream("web-app/WEB-INF/...") 此外,如果您尝试在客户端上使用 .wsdl 文件,最好指定服务器的 uri 而不是物理地址。

    【讨论】:

    • 我使用一个 java lib,它使用外部配置文件。来自 Stateless Bean 的 Lib 调用,而不是来自 jsp 或 servlet。
    • 我找到了解决方法,但问题仍然存在。 stackoverflow.com/questions/1485987/… "Glassfish 默认将 [Glassfish 安装位置]\glassfish\domains[您的域]\ 作为默认工作目录" 所以我将配置文件放在这个目录中并创建相对路径。
    猜你喜欢
    • 1970-01-01
    • 2013-08-11
    • 2014-09-08
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2015-06-21
    • 2013-01-08
    相关资源
    最近更新 更多